Q Interactive acquires Vente from Experian

Mary Elizabeth Hurn October 08, 2009

Ad network Q Interactive has acquired permission-based marketing firm Vente from Experian. The deal, signed October 1, is Q Interactive's second acquisition in three months. It bought e-mail firm Postmaster Direct in July. Matt Wise, president and CEO of Q Interactive, would not disclose financial terms of the Vente deal but said it happened "very quickly" and that the companies opened dialogue two months ago.
 

Reynolds DeWalt acquires RiverView to boost direct mail capabilities

Kevin McKeefery October 06, 2009

Reynolds DeWalt acquired RiverView Marketing Consultants, a direct marketing services company, effective October 5. Reynolds DeWalt, a multichannel agency, made the acquisition to boost its direct mailing capabilities, particularly in database management and analytics services for mail campaigns, in which RiverView specialized.
 

Jones fills EVP slot at Arc Worldwide

Nathan Golia October 05, 2009

Arc Worldwide, the direct marketing arm of Chicago-based agency Leo Burnett, has appointed Nick Jones its EVP, retail practice lead and account director. The former managing director of Draftfcb agency Rivet London is charged with improving Arc's retail unit, which includes clients McDonald's, Comcast and Procter & Gamble, in the new position.

Zappos.com names Mullen creative AOR; online DM to stay in house

Chantal Todé September 25, 2009

As it strives to create a more holistic marketing plan for next year, Zappos.com has named Mullen its creative AOR, with responsibility for brand development, media buying and creative, including digital advertising. The agency will work closely with King Fish Media, Zappos.com's partner for offline direct marketing.
